    I think it might be a coin of Philipp Christoph Von Sotern. He was the bishop of Speyer and archbishop of Trier my eyes could be fooling me but i think i can make out 25 in the legend which would indicate 1625.I cannot find the coin in any reference I have or by searching online. That Z in the coat of arms does show up on some of his coins. Hope this helps.
